Location
This non-smoking hotel is set 2.3 miles from Potbelly Beach and 1.6 miles from the big Twin Lakes State Beach. The hotel is situated in a shopping district, within walking distance of Jade Street Park. The free beach is a 17-minute walk away. 1.9 miles from Walton Lighthouse is a perk for guests staying at Fairfield Inn & Suites Santa Cruz - Capitola.
The bus stop 41st Avenue & Brommer Street is located fairly close to this accommodation.
Rooms
Some rooms feature blackout drapes, an ironing set, and air conditioning, as well as a flat-screen TV with satellite channels for your convenience. Along with a fireplace and sound-proofed windows, they also have a writing desk. Providing a roll-in shower and a separate toilet, the bathrooms are also equipped with hair dryers.
Eat & Drink
This Capitola hotel invites guests to the lounge bar to relax with a drink. Guests can dine at Erik's DeliCafe Capitola a 5-minute walk from the accommodation.
Leisure & Business
A hot tub and various recreational opportunities are available at the Fairfield Inn & Suites Santa Cruz. Thanks to a golf course, guests can stay fit at this hotel. The Fairfield Inn & Suites Santa Cruz Capitola also provides a business center for those arriving on business.
